Solution for 4-2y=7-6y+4y equation:


Simplifying
4 + -2y = 7 + -6y + 4y

Combine like terms: -6y + 4y = -2y
4 + -2y = 7 + -2y

Add '2y' to each side of the equation.
4 + -2y + 2y = 7 + -2y + 2y

Combine like terms: -2y + 2y = 0
4 + 0 = 7 + -2y + 2y
4 = 7 + -2y + 2y

Combine like terms: -2y + 2y = 0
4 = 7 + 0
4 = 7

Solving
4 = 7

Couldn't find a variable to solve for.

This equation is invalid, the left and right sides are not equal, therefore there is no solution.
